Headcorn to Baldock by train

A train trip from Headcorn to Baldock takes about 2hrs 38 mins on average, covering roughly 67 miles (107 kilometres). With around 39 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£53.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Headcorn to Baldock are available for £53.00 one way, or £86.50 return

Facilities and Amenities at Headcorn Station

Headcorn Station is equipped with a well-staffed ticket office and easy ticket collection options. Whether you're a daily commuter or a weekend explorer, you’ll find services tailored for convenience with ticket machines accessible in the station forecourt. Friendly staff are available to offer help and support, particularly through the designated help point.

While CCTV ensures security throughout the station, those seeking a moment of relaxation can enjoy refreshments from a coffee kiosk or choose from an assortment of newspapers. Cycling enthusiasts are catered for with secure bicycle storage spaces. However, do note that facilities such as baggage storage and extensive waiting rooms are not available, and public Wi-Fi isn’t currently offered at the station.

Travel Connections from Headcorn Station

To ease your onward journey, Headcorn provides solid transport links. Taxi services are readily accessible at the end of the station building. For those affected by service disruptions, rail replacement options can be conveniently accessed from the station's Ashford side. Facilities and Accessibility at Baldock Station

Baldock Train Station comes with essential amenities to make your journey smooth and comfortable. It has a ticket office operational from early in the morning until early afternoon on weekdays and Saturdays, although it is not open on Sundays. For those who prefer pre-booking tickets online, ticket collection is available through accessible ticket machines designed to cater for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ts too.

There are help points scattered across the station for timely assistance, although note that staff are available only during certain hours. Be mindful that the station lacks step-free access, which might be a point to consider for anyone with mobility restrictions.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ms, refreshments, or luggage storage facilities, so planning ahead is crucial. On the flip side, the station is secured with CCTV for added safety.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Connections from Baldock Train Station extend beyond the railway lines. Though direct rail replacement services are somewhat limited, onward bus journeys can be planned using the Onward Travel Information Map available at the station.
